Description

The letter or notice by which a claim is transferred to a collection agency need not take any particular form. However, since collection agencies handle overdue accounts on a volume basis and generally develop regular clients, it may be desirable that such instruments be standardized. The letter or notice should be clear as to whether it is an assignment of the claim and, thus, enables the agency to bring suit on the claim in its own name. Whether a collection agency may solicit and accept assignments of claims from creditors depends on the law of the particular jurisdiction. Local statutes should be consulted to determine the allowable scope of activities of collection agencies.

Introduction. On July 24, 1701, Antoine de La Mothe Cadillac, accompanied by approximately one hundred fellow Frenchmen and an additional one hundred Algonquian Indians, established Fort Pontchartrain du Detroit on a site that is today in downtown Detroit.

The Metro Detroit area, home to 4.3 million people, is the second-largest in the Midwest after the Chicago metropolitan area and the 14th-largest in the United States.

Long known as the automobile capital of the world, Detroit is also famous for its distinctive Motown music sound from the 1960s. Detroit is home to a rich mix of people from various ethnic backgrounds, including citizens of Italian, English, German, Polish, Irish, Mexican, Middle Eastern, African, and Greek descent.
